AutoRacingSport.com A mid-afternoon downpour has washed away NASCAR Sprint Cup qualifying. The lineup for Sunday’s race will be set by owner points, with series leader Tony Stewart starting from the pole despite crashing and having to move to a backup car in Friday’s opening practice.
